MCP配置

https://alekschen.github.io/post/2504-cursor-figma-mcp/ figma mcp 配置: 全局下载,启动本地端口: pnpx figma-developer-mcp --figma-api-key=<YOUR_FIGMA_API_KEY> cursor中配置: { "mcpServers": { "Figma": { "url": "http://localhost:3333/sse" } } } mastergo { "mcpServers": { "mastergo-magic-mcp": { "command": "npx", "args": [ "-y", "@mastergo/magic-mcp", "--token=<YOUR_MASTERGO_TOKEN>", "--url=https://mastergo.com" ], "env": { "NPM_CONFIG_REGISTRY": "https://registry.npmjs.org/" } } } } mcp-feedback-enhanced: { "mcpServers": { "mcp-feedback-enhanced": { "command": "uvx", "args": [ "mcp-feedback-enhanced@latest" ] } } } context7: ...

四月 8, 2026 · 1 分钟 · Rui

React

文档:[https://17.reactjs.org/docs/getting-started.html] 核心要点 你想做的事 React 里常用 Vue 里常用 页面加载后执行一次 useEffect(…, []) onMounted 页面销毁前清理 useEffect 返回清理函数 onUnmounted 监听某个值变化 useEffect(…, [value]) watch 自动追踪依赖执行副作用 useEffect(手动写依赖) watchEffect 根据状态计算新值 useMemo computed 代码整理: hello world 注意需要使用==type=“text/jsx”== ...

四月 8, 2026 · 3 分钟 · Rui

CSS省略号

单行文本 overflow: hidden; white-space: nowrap; text-overflow: ellipsis; 多行文本 display: -webkit-box; -webkit-box-orient: vertical; -webkit-line-clamp: 3;/* 设置为想要的行数 */ overflow: hidden; text-overflow: ellipsis; nvue overflow: hidden; text-overflow: ellipsis; display: -webkit-box; -webkit-box-orient: vertical; -webkit-line-clamp: 1; /* 显示的行数 */ lines: 1; /* NVUE下要用这个属性,来让文字超出隐藏变省略号 */

四月 8, 2026 · 1 分钟 · Rui

Git提交规范

feat: 新功能、新特性 fix: 修改 bug perf: 更改代码,以提高性能 refactor: 代码重构(重构,在不影响代码内部行为、功能下的代码修改) docs: 文档修改 style: 代码格式修改, 注意不是 css 修改(例如分号修改) test: 测试用例新增、修改 build: 影响项目构建或依赖项修改 revert: 恢复上一次提交 ci: 持续集成相关文件修改 chore: 其他修改(不在上述类型中的修改) release: 发布新版本 workflow: 工作流相关文件修改 scope: commit 影响的范围, 比如: route, component, utils, build… subject: commit 的概述 body: commit 具体修改内容, 可以分为多行. footer: 一些备注, 通常是 BREAKING CHANGE 或修复的 bug 的链接. 示例: ...

四月 8, 2026 · 2 分钟 · Rui

nacos安装

官方文档: https://nacos.io/docs/latest/quickstart/quick-start/?spm=5238cd80.72a042d5.0.0.5bc0cd36gYSNAV bin目录下 启动命令: startup.cmd -m standalone 启动报错指南: https://blog.csdn.net/qq_45063782/article/details/119751892 https://blog.csdn.net/weixin_45396074/article/details/135177158 需要在本地mysql手动创建nacos数据库 修改配置: secret.key 不得少于32位,不然会报错,直接把官方的注释解开即可 ...

四月 8, 2026 · 1 分钟 · Rui

FigmaMCP提示词

你是一名资深全栈工程师,请基于我提供的 Figma 设计链接生成响应式小程序页面,并使用Figma mcp工具查看UI设计稿。 要求: 严格还原间距和颜色 对移动设备做适配处理 其中若涉及图标、背景图等信息,告知我代码中对应图标的名称,我会手动下载保存在腾讯云cos上 若涉及新功能开发,你是一名优秀的经验丰富的全栈工程师,需要完成sql表创建、后端编写以及前端编写工作 若需要顶部导航栏,则使用小程序原生的顶部导航栏,页面的宽高需要考虑padding的距离,必要时使用calc设置宽高 设计链接: https://www.figma.com/design/xXcKJz1amnqrNGR32JSWoI/Untitled?node-id=30-299&t=g9zYjchPWTYzvXoA-0

四月 8, 2026 · 1 分钟 · Rui

React全家桶技术栈

层级 技术选型 语言 TypeScript 前端(Web) Next.js + Tailwind + shadcn/ui 移动端(App) React Native + Expo + NativeWind 小程序 Taro(React 语法) 数据库 Supabase(数据库 + Auth + Realtime + Edge Functions) AI 层 OpenAI SDK + LangChain + pgvector 状态管理 Zustand / React Query 部署 Vercel(Web) + Expo EAS(App) + 微信开发者工具(小程序) Web:Next.js+Supabase App: React Native+Next.js+Supabase 小程序:Taro+Next.js+Supabase

四月 8, 2026 · 1 分钟 · Rui

如何使用 MuMu模拟器和 Android Studio 调试应用

https://mumu.163.com/help/20240903/40912_1178625.html D:\App\MuMuPlayer\nx_device\12.0\shell> adb.exe connect 127.0.0.1:7555 新版本adb.exe 路径 “D:\App\MuMuPlayer\nx_device\12.0\shell\adb.exe” “D:\App\MuMuPlayer\nx_main\adb.exe” uniapp调试运行到mumu模拟器 D:\App\HBuilderX\plugins\launcher-tools\tools\adbs\adb.exe

四月 8, 2026 · 1 分钟 · Rui